Now Hiring: Lead Engineer – Mechanical & Civil Systems
Location: Worcestor, MA (Hybrid, with occasional travel. Will assist with relocation)
Employment Type: Full-time
Work Authorization: Due to the nature of the projects, candidates must be a US Citizen or Permanent Resident of the United States.

We’re looking for a highly motivated Lead Engineer to manage and deliver small to mid-sized technical projects with a focus on mechanical and civil engineering systems. In this role, you'll take ownership of engineering analysis, design modifications, and failure investigations, while collaborating with cross-functional teams and clients. This is a great opportunity for an analytical thinker who excels in both field and office environments and thrives on solving complex engineering challenges.

What You’ll Do:

  • Perform engineering calculations and root cause analysis using client-provided data

  • Develop and refine plant design changes ensuring compliance with applicable codes and standards

  • Lead onsite implementation of system modifications and support field walkdowns

  • Evaluate pressure vessel and piping failures and recommend improvements

  • Analyze degradation mechanisms such as Flow-Accelerated Corrosion and MIC

  • Support geometry and structural evaluations of piping and supports

  • Communicate directly with clients and stakeholders, ensuring timely response to technical requests

  • Lead small engineering teams and contribute to successful project delivery

✅ What You Bring:

  • Bachelor's degree in Mechanical or Civil Engineering (MS or MBA is a plus)

  • Project management experience leading engineering teams (≤5 engineers) for power generation projects

  • PE license in any state (or PEng in Canada) required

  • Experience with FEA tools and stress analysis techniques

  • Familiarity with relevant codes and standards (ASME, AISC, etc.)

  • Experience with root cause and metallurgical failure analysis

  • Utility or field experience with complex mechanical systems (BWR/PWR experience a plus)

  • Proficient with tools like AutoCAD, AutoPIPE, and Microsoft Office

  • Strong communication, report writing, and client-facing skills

  • Willingness to travel occasionally for field assignments
